Biography

Emilia Johansson is a doctoral student at Umeå University, specializing in the field of taste perception and its underlying mechanisms. Her research focuses on the influence of fat and sugar on sweet taste perception in Drosophila, providing insights into the complex interactions between nutritional signals and sensory processing. Emilia is part of a research group led by Mattias Alenius, where she collaborates with fellow researchers to investigate the hedgehog-mediated gut-taste neuron axis and its role in regulating sweet perception. Through her work, Emilia aims to contribute to our understanding of how taste perception is modulated by various dietary components, potentially informing future studies on nutritional influences on taste. She has co-authored several publications in renowned journals, advancing the knowledge of sensory biology.
